1. Navodaya Sangh – Eden Woods, Khewra Circle

One of the most popular Durga Puja pandals in Thane, Navodaya Sangh at Eden Woods, Khewra Circle, is known for its grand decorations and cultural programs. The beautifully crafted idol of Maa Durga here attracts thousands of devotees every year.

2. New Bengal Club – Manpada

The New Bengal Club in Manpada is among the oldest and most respected Durga Puja organizers in Thane. With traditional rituals, bhog (prasadam), and cultural evenings, it offers visitors a truly authentic Bengali festive experience.

3. Aamra Probashi – Hiranandani Estate

Located in the heart of Hiranandani Estate, Aamra Probashi is famous for its artistic pandal designs and cultural performances. Families and youngsters gather here to enjoy the festive vibes, making it a must-visit spot during Durga Puja in Thane.

4. Bangiya Parishad – Highland Gardens

The Bangiya Parishad at Highland Gardens is another landmark Durga Puja in Thane. Known for its vibrant cultural shows, community spirit, and traditional Bengali bhog, it has become a highlight of the city’s festive celebrations.

5. Bengali Sarbojanin – Kisan Nagar

At Kisan Nagar, the Bengali Sarbojanin Durga Puja brings together devotees from all across Thane. The pandal is admired for its devotion, simplicity, and inclusive community celebration.
